Er, AFAIK, it isn't SACLOS either. According to globalsecurity it is fire-and-forget. According to this article they're not making them any more at all.77SiCaRiO77 wrote:the SRAW PREDATOR is fire n' forget , but is no longer produced , the one in PR should be the SRAW MPV , witch is used as a bunker buster and anti light armor , and it isnt fire n' forget .
Also, it wouldn't make much sense for the SRAW in game to be of the -MPV variant. On Basra - maybe, but while the Predator wasn't designed for the kind of warfare we see today in Iraq, it WAS designed for the kind of warfare we see in PR on non-insurgency maps. It would also make more sense that way as a counterpart to the ERYX.
I guess the main problem is that the SRAW doesn't seem to be very widespread in the USMC. I guess these days they don't really need to spend too much money on AT equipment for infantry, and if infantry does need to perform AT roles, there's the Javelin, which is superior to the SRAW
